Solution for 7y+y+14=8y-4+3y equation:


Simplifying
7y + y + 14 = 8y + -4 + 3y

Reorder the terms:
14 + 7y + y = 8y + -4 + 3y

Combine like terms: 7y + y = 8y
14 + 8y = 8y + -4 + 3y

Reorder the terms:
14 + 8y = -4 + 8y + 3y

Combine like terms: 8y + 3y = 11y
14 + 8y = -4 + 11y

Solving
14 + 8y = -4 + 11y

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-11y' to each side of the equation.
14 + 8y + -11y = -4 + 11y + -11y

Combine like terms: 8y + -11y = -3y
14 + -3y = -4 + 11y + -11y

Combine like terms: 11y + -11y = 0
14 + -3y = -4 + 0
14 + -3y = -4

Add '-14' to each side of the equation.
14 + -14 + -3y = -4 + -14

Combine like terms: 14 + -14 = 0
0 + -3y = -4 + -14
-3y = -4 + -14

Combine like terms: -4 + -14 = -18
-3y = -18

Divide each side by '-3'.
y = 6

Simplifying
y = 6
